Preparation

  1. 1

    Put the kernels in a large microwave-safe bowl. Cover with a plate.

  2. 2

    Microwave for 2–3 min at full power (1000W). Stop as soon as more than 2 seconds pass between pops.

    3 min

    💡 Do not wait until every kernel has popped, or the popcorn will burn.

  3. 3

    Pour over the melted butter and salt. Shake. For a sweet version, use icing sugar instead of salt.

Frequently asked questions

Why does my popcorn burn?
The power is too high or the cooking time is too long. Stop as soon as the popping slows down.
